@tallyforms/coding-test

This is a coding test to gain insights into your coding style, approach to problem solving, and general capabilities.

Context

  • You are given a Next.js app with some relevant pieces of code that mimic how Tally works.
  • You are given a database with a few million rows of dummy data that includes;
    • Forms
    • Questions
    • Submissions
    • Answers
  • There's only 3 types of answers used in the dummy data;
    • text-long
    • text-short
    • linear-scale (0 - 10, an NPS score)

Important

The answers in the database are encrypted using AES-256-CBC, (src/services/encryption.ts).

Expectations

  • You should be able to click on a form to go to its detail page.
    • Submissions tab, similar to the one Tally has, to browse through submissions chronologically.
    • Summary tab, similar to the one Tally has, per question type.
      • For the linear-scale question type, show an average score.
  • Improve & change the code where needed.
  • While you are free to make it look as nice as you want, it won't be our main focus.
  • We do not expect a form builder, so do not spend time on that.
  • Try to timebox yourself to 4 hours.
  • Commit your changes in git.

Note

  • You are free to change or add any additional tooling as you see fit.
  • You are free to change or add any additional libraries as you see fit.
  • You are free to use any styling libraries as you see fit.
  • You are free to make changes to the database structure.
  • You are free to make use of additional Docker services.

Setup

Environment

Create the .env file, there's no need to adjust values.

cp .env.example .env

Database

Download the sql dump init.sql.gz (0.5GB) using the following command.

curl --progress-bar -L https://dropbox.com/scl/fi/0q59tbdfjup45o870vvpf/init.sql.gz?rlkey=xjwajfuxheroa5cqhqm0gylni&dl=1 | gunzip > init.sql

Import the sql dump by starting the docker services (on the foreground), this might take a minute or 2.

docker compose up

Tip

Once you see the log line MySQL init process done, you can press Ctrl + C & proceed.

Running

# start docker services
docker compose up -d

# install dependencies
npm install

# start dev server
npm run dev

Debugging

There are 2 scripts provided to help you debug more easily;

  1. inspecting answer data
# inspect answer with id 100
npm run debug:inspect-answer -- --id 100
  1. adding data to a form
# create a submission for form with id 1
npm run debug:add-data -- --id 1
